Autonomous and Semi-Autonomous Cybersecurity Training

Cybersecurity in Autonomous and Semi-Autonomous Systems is a 3-day particular program, focuses on vulnerabilities in autonomous and semi-autonomous systems, implanted systems, apparatuses, methods, methodologies and techniques to dissect and plan.

The course will cover existing in-vehicle correspondence conventions, and related vulnerabilities just as the constraints of existing computerized crime scene investigation.




Learning Objectives :

  • Understand the basics of cybersecurity
  • Recognize the cybersecurity applied to autonomous and semi-autonomous systems
  • Identify basics of threat models
  • Determine industry standards
  • Describe basic functions of sensors, ECUs and CAN bus
  • Acquire and analyze in-vehicle communication data
  • Hack autonomous and semi-autonomous systems, ECUs, sensors and communication buses such as CAN
  • Use tools for autonomous and semi-autonomous systems anomaly detection


Prerequisites :

Basics of electronics in vehicle systems, autonomous and semi-autonomous systems is recommended.

Who Should Attend?

  • Law Enforcement Professionals
  • Motor Manufacturers
  • Systems and Part Manufacturers
  • Software Developers


Course Outlines :

  • Cybersecurity applied to embedded systems
  • Autonomous and semi-autonomous cybersecurity
  • Autonomous and semi-autonomous systems network security evaluation
  • Functional safety testing
  • Cyber security threats and strategies
  • Automotive end-to-end security solutions
  • Case study and labs: machine learning can detect and prevent attacks and more
